Chapter 4: Research Rescue

Post by Fel »

Flight Officer Gann sat in the pilots' lounge with Arkada, Irinek and Wistalin. It was an unusually early hour of the evening, but he had already seen action earlier that morning, against the pirates, and he was just killing time before the briefing. "I like the new name. Obsidian squadron," he said. "It's all dark and foreboding sounding."

Arkada smiled. "Yeah, it's great. Unfortunately I doubt we're the only Obsidian Squadron in the whole Rebel... New Republic... but we're the only one in this fleet."

"A shame I won't get to fly under that banner now. I've been told to report to the ground troops briefing tonight." Irinek didn't look happy. "And you can bet Viru is going to be there." He said the name Viru with some malice.

Wistalin gave a disapproving look. "You two really need to get past those things."

Irinek remained calm. "I know you are an outsider, so I will forgive your ignorance. But nothing matters more than the clan. Our clans quarreled many years ago, and the insults are not easily forgotten."

Wistalin blushed a little. "I'm sorry, Eerie..."

Irinek smiled, though this gesture was somewhat unnatural, given his species. "Think nothing of it."

Gann interrupted, trying to steer the conversation to more pleasant topics. "I'm looking forward to seeing some real action. Not just these training exercises and chasing after some cowardly pirates."

"True honour in combat comes from looking your opponent in the eye," Irinek said. "I look forward to seeing you on the field of combat. Through combat, we shall gain glory."

"Hopefully this time a mechanical failure won't keep the Pike out of the action." Gann grinned.

"Are you so certain it was mechanical failure?" Wistalin was suspicious.

"Well, that's what we heard, and even though it could be sabotage, I really doubt it," said Arkada. "I've been looking at some stuff and in some places, it looks like the ship is held together with spit and plastape."

"You'd think they might take better care in the engine room," Gann interrupted, "It's kind of important."

Irinek's predatory smile still looked disconcerting. "Better for us if they stay out of the fight - more glory for us...!"

==========

Later that day, all pilots were assembled and sitting in the briefing room. At the same time, the commando briefing was taking place in another briefing room.

"As most of you have noticed, we've joined up with our normal task unit after a couple of detours. No matter - we are still on track with our assignment for this cycle."

"Our main project is moving forward, but we have a bit of a problem. Three key scientists with expertise in the area are currently prisoners of Warlord Harrsk. And we need to rescue them from their captivity."

Fel felt some internal relief that the target was Harrsk's and not Daemon's. Harrsk was no friend to the other Imperials in the galaxy, having styled himself a warlord and attempted to usurp the rightful Imperial chain of command...

Ilven pulled up a particular planet on the holographic map. "We believe they are being held here, on the planet we're calling Sandbox. They are being held there following what we can only imagine to be a show trial. We'd like to pick them up and take them to safety."

"Sounds pretty easy, yes? Here's what's been given to us by our flag officer for the plan of this attack..."

Ilven adjusted the map. "We will have three groups. The first group has been assigned to draw Harrsk's attention away, by attacking a nearby system. They will not be trying to cause serious damage - only draw the defenders out of the Sandbox system."

One droup of signals disappeared off the map. "Groups two and three are headed in to the system. We are a part of group two, the group who is required to draw their fighters away from the shuttle and our landing party, by attacking an installation. During this tine, our third group will head in and land on the planet. We need to make this look good, like it's our primary target, so we really have to go all out on the attack. Otherwise they will realize the planet is our real target.

"Colonel Valov has been briefing the commandos at present, and they should be ready to go. We launch in two hours."
